How to prepare for a job interview at Experian Ltd
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on the latest trends in offensive security. Familiarise yourself with common vulnerabilities, penetration testing tools, and methodologies. Being able to discuss these topics confidently will show that you're not just a candidate, but a knowledgeable expert.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Prepare specific examples from your past work that demonstrate your skills in offensive security. Whether it's a successful penetration test or a project where you identified and mitigated risks, having concrete stories ready will help you stand out.
✨Ask Smart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are insightful questions about Experian's approach to security challenges, their tech stack, or how they handle incident response.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if the company is the right fit for you.
✨Stay Calm and Collected
Technical interviews can be intense, but remember to take a deep breath and stay calm. If you encounter a tricky question, don’t panic—think it through and communicate your thought process. This demonstrates your problem-solving skills and ability to handle pressure.
